CBX One. Stop shall submit to BellSouth a notice of its intent to access and utilize BellSouth CNAM Database Services. Said notice shall be in writing no less than sixty (60) calendar days prior to CBX One-Stop’s access to BellSouth’s CNAM Database Services and shall be addressed to CBX One-Stop’s Local Contract Manager.
CBX One. Stop may provide its own splitters or may order splitters in a central office once it has installed its DSLAM in that central office. BellSouth will install splitters within thirty-six (36) calendar days of CBX One-Stop’s submission of an error free Line Splitter Ordering Document (LSOD) to the BellSouth Complex Resale Support Group.

CBX One. Stop may reserve facilities for up to four (4) business days for each facility requested through LMU from the time the LMU information is returned to CBX One-Stop. During and prior to CBX One-Stop placing an LSR, the reserved facilities are rendered unavailable to other customers, including BellSouth. If CBX One-Stop does not submit an LSR for a UNE service on a reserved facility within the four (4)-day reservation timeframe, the reservation of that spare facility will become invalid and the facility will be released.
